王占斌  赵德明  刘红  毛薇 《中国饲料》2012,(6):22-24,30
以毛泡桐皮为原料,通过乙醇提取,大孔吸附树脂纯化,分别得到毛泡桐皮黄酮的粗提物和纯化物。利用油脂酸败法,测定油脂的过氧化值(POV)和诱导期(IP),计算抗氧化系数(PF)。根据抗氧化系数的大小,确定毛泡桐皮黄酮提取物抗氧化能力的大小。试验结果表明:在相同浓度下,毛泡桐皮黄酮提取物抗氧化能力的大小为:毛泡桐皮黄酮纯化物>粗提物>原粉;并且随着浓度的增加抗氧化能力逐渐增大,其存在着剂量效应关系;0.1%毛泡桐皮黄酮纯化物的抗氧化系数大于2,具有较强的抗氧化能力;0.1%毛泡桐皮黄酮纯化物的抗氧化能力与0.02%BHT的抗氧化能力相当,0.06%毛泡桐皮黄酮纯化物的抗氧化能力与0.05%维生素C的抗氧化能力相当。  相似文献

李栋 《中国饲料》2021,1(9):34-41
本文采用一种新型绿色溶剂提取红枣总黄酮,并对其提取工艺进行优化。通过单因素试验探究含水量、超声功率、提取时间、提取温度和料液比对红枣总黄酮得率的影响。在此基础上,采用遗传算法优化超声辅助低共熔溶剂提取红枣总黄酮工艺。结果表明:超声辅助低共熔溶剂提取红枣总黄酮最优的工艺参数为:含水量37%、超声功率167 W、提取时间30 min、提取温度54 ℃和料液比1∶26(g/mL)。在此条件下,所得红枣总黄酮得率为(29.33±0.37)mg/g。试验值和理论值的相对误差为1.24%。表明遗传算法可较好地模拟和预测不同提取条件下红枣总黄酮得率,且优化工艺参数是可行的。研究发现低共熔溶剂可作为一种新型、绿色溶剂用于高效提取红枣总黄酮。[关键词] 遗传算法|红枣|总黄酮|低共熔溶剂|工艺  相似文献

杂交构树叶多酚提取工艺优化及其抗氧化活性研究   总被引:1,自引:0,他引:1  
为建立和优化杂交构树叶多酚的提取工艺,本试验采用超声波辅助提取的方法,以构树叶多酚得率为考察指标,通过单因素试验研究液料比、乙醇浓度、超声时间、超声温度4个因素对构树叶多酚得率的影响;在单因素试验的基础上,借助响应面法设计4因素3水平的试验方案,对构树叶多酚提取的工艺参数进行优化,建立回归模型并进行响应面分析,最终确定最佳的提取工艺参数,并进行3次平行验证;以维生素C为对照,通过测定构树叶多酚对DPPH和ABTS自由基的清除率,评价构树叶多酚的体外抗氧化活性。结果显示:4个因素对构树叶多酚得率的影响顺序依次为:乙醇浓度(B) > 液料比(A) > 超声温度(D) > 超声时间(C),响应面分析结果显示:两两因素之间存在交互作用,但交互作用不显著(P>0.05);在液料比为70:1、乙醇浓度为60%、超声时间为50 min、超声温度50 ℃的条件下,构树叶多酚的得率最大,为13.62 mg/g,与响应面法的预测值接近;体外抗氧化试验结果表明,构树叶多酚可以清除DPPH和ABTS自由基,并且在高浓度情况下可以达到与维生素C相当的水平。综上,试验建立的构树叶多酚提取工艺准确、可行,同时证明构树叶多酚具有良好的抗氧化活性;该结果可为构树叶多酚的生物活性研究以及构树叶的药用价值开发提供参考。  相似文献

在刚性面层下设置一道性能良好的保温层来防止基土冻结,可以从根本上解决冻胀破坏的问题。这种带保温层的刚性护面渠道称为保温型刚性护面渠道,根据热工原理,提出了保温型刚性护面渠道横断面设计在构造方面的要求,进一步推导出计算保温层厚度的有关公式,并给出算例,还指出了需要进一步研究和探讨的问题。  相似文献

Four Japanese black beef cows were used in a 4 × 4 Latin square to evaluate the fermentation quality, digestibility, ruminal fermentation and preference of total mixed ration (TMR) silages prepared with differing proportions of apple pomace (AP). Experimental treatments were the control (no AP added, CAP), 5% (low, LAP), 10% (medium, MAP) and 20% (high, HAP) of TMR dry matter (DM) as AP. All TMR silages were well preserved. Ethanol was produced in silages containing AP and the amount increased with the proportion of AP (P < 0.05). Nutrient digestibility with LAP, MAP and HAP treatment was lower than that with CAP treatment (P < 0.05). The ruminal molar proportion of acetic acid increased (P < 0.05), but the ruminal ammonia‐N concentration decreased (P < 0.05) as the proportion of AP increased. The preference of the animals was highest for HAP, followed by MAP, CAP and LAP. This study demonstrates that decrease in nutrient digestibility might be related to the ethanol produced naturally from AP. Therefore, the proportion of AP in TMR silages should be less than 5% of dietary DM.  相似文献

Portable blood glucose meters (PBGM, glucometers) are a convenient, cost effective, and quick means to assess patient blood glucose concentration. The number of commercially available PBGM is constantly increasing, making it challenging to determine whether certain glucometers may have benefits over others for veterinary testing. The challenge in selection of an appropriate glucometer from a quality perspective is compounded by the variety of analytic methods used to quantify glucose concentrations and disparate statistical analysis in many published studies. These guidelines were developed as part of the ASVCP QALS committee response to establish recommendations to improve the quality of testing using point‐of‐care testing (POCT) handheld and benchtop devices in veterinary medicine. They are intended for clinical pathologists and laboratory professionals to provide them with background knowledge and specific recommendations for quality assurance (QA) and quality control (QC), and to serve as a resource to assist the provision of advice to veterinarians and technicians to improve the quality of results obtained when using PBGM. These guidelines are not intended to be all‐inclusive; rather they provide a minimum standard for management of PBGM in the veterinary setting.  相似文献

Coriander and white mustard, an annual plants originated in the Mediterranean region, have been cultivated and used as spices for a long time. Recent studies have shown that they may constitute a potential source of phenolic compounds. The aim of this study was to evaluate the content of polyphenols in coriander and white mustard water extracts and to investigate their antioxidant activity in C2C12 mouse skeletal muscle cells, which serve as a good model of cells with intensive metabolism. HPLC analysis showed that polyphenols were able to permeate from the water extracts of studied plants into the undifferentiated myoblasts as well as myocytes undergoing differentiation, increasing the concentration of reduced glutathione and upregulating glutathione reductase and peroxidase activity. White mustard and coriander extracts also decreased the levels of oxysterols and sum of tiobarbituric acid reactive substances (TBARS) in both: myoblasts and differentiating myocytes, demonstrating protective effect on cell membranes. The obtained results indicate that polyphenols synthesized by both herbs may have beneficial effects on muscle tissue.  相似文献

To understand the background value of phosphorus in chickens, the quantitative distribution of different phosphorus forms, including total phosphorus (TP), free phosphate (FP) and phospholipid (PL), in viscera, blood and bones of broiler chickens was investigated. Results showed that phosphorus contents exhibited significant differences in different parts of chickens. TP content of breast and thigh meat was over 5.0 g/kg, in which most of the phosphorus was in the form of water‐soluble phosphates. TP content in viscera was higher than that in meat, and spleen was observed to contain the highest amount of phosphorus (10.0 g/kg). In all tested organs, FP and PL contents in liver were the highest, ranging between 1207–1989 and 81–369 mg/kg respectively. TP content in chicken bone was in the range of 52 716–136 643 mg/kg, and FP content in the bone was relatively lower than that in chicken meat.  相似文献
